92-95 AM. "From Petit Maupertui . . . . there is first-rate volume, punch and mid-palate density to the muscular flavors that are also quite firmly structured but even so there is less youthful austerity than is typical for Clos de Vougeot. Still, this is definitely going to require at least moderate patience and like the Chambertin, this is excellent as well." Allen Meadows, Burghound.com, Apr 2017 |
